Macro para que se ejecute dentro de un rango

Para DAM

Aquí la nueva pregunta

Que la macro actúe en un rango sin tener que seleccionar ninguna celda o rango sin tener que mostrar la hoja.

'La Macro para Eliminar los espacios en inicio, intermedios y finales de la cadena de texto es esta última:
Sub EspaciosVacios_TodaHoja()
'Por.Dante Amor
    Dim celda As Range
    For Each celda In Sheets("Hoja1").Cells.SpecialCells(xlCellTypeConstants, 23)
        celda.Value = WorksheetFunction.Trim(celda.Value)
    Next
End Sub

1 respuesta

Respuesta
1

H o l a:

Si es para un rango:

Sub EspaciosVacios_TodaHoja()
'Por.Dante Amor
    Dim celda As Range
    For Each celda In Sheets("Hoja1").range("A1:C10")
        celda.Value = WorksheetFunction.Trim(celda.Value)
    Next
End Sub

sal u dos

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as